The music teacher ran out of providers who took his health insurance, but luckily the New Jersey public school system <a href=\"https:\/\/www.nj.gov\/humanservices\/clients\/family\/special\/12_SpecialEducationFactSheet.pdf\">provided him<\/a> with an independent neurologist, who diagnosed his son with autism on April 3.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>VanPelt was <em>thrilled<\/em>. His son \u2014 prone to sensory overload and outbursts when deviating from his routine \u2014 would finally get the individualized attention he needed. But the father\u2019s excitement quickly curdled to fear in the following weeks, as federal health leaders <a href=\"https:\/\/www.statnews.com\/2025\/04\/15\/rfk-jr-says-rising-autism-rates-an-epidemic-researchers-disagree\/\">announced<\/a> <a href=\"https:\/\/www.statnews.com\/2025\/04\/24\/no-new-autism-registry-hhs-says-contradicting-nih-director-jay-bhattacharya-claim\/\">initiatives<\/a> aimed at finding autism\u2019s origins.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cDid we just screw up our child\u2019s life? In seeking to help him, did I just paint a giant target on his back?\u201d he wondered.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>For now, VanPelt plans to hold off filing any health insurance claims for his son\u2019s diagnosis. He is not alone. People with autism and parents of autistic kids are asking clinicians to erase their diagnoses and cancelling appointments with medical professionals, according to interviews conducted in recent days at an international autism conference.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Amy Esler, a pediatric psychologist at the University of Minnesota, said she has heard of similar cancellations from peers across the country through the International Collaboration for Diagnostic Evaluation of Autism network, which includes more than 20 major autism care and research centers such as Vanderbilt University Medical Center. Families seeking a pre-diagnosis evaluation from the University of North Carolina TEACCH Autism Program have removed themselves from the waitlist, according to Hannah Morton, a UNC psychiatry professor. Multiple organizations declined to comment about the issue.<\/p>\n<p>The cancellations are driven by panic and distrust among the autism community in response to the recent remarks made by health secretary Robert F.
